Conquer the Trail: How to Pack a North Face Backpack for Exploration

Packing your North Face backpack for an adventure demands more than just stuffing it full of items. You need to organize your load smartly for a comfortable and successful trek.

First, prioritize your must-haves. Consider the length of your trip, the terrain, and the forecast. Utilize the different compartments in your backpack for optimal organization.

A good rule of thumb is to stow heavier items closer your spine. This helps to balance the weight and prevent strain on your shoulders. Roll your clothing efficiently to save space.

Keep in mind to pack a few garments for unexpected changes in temperature. And always carry a medical supplies for any minor mishaps.

By following these tips, you'll be well equipped to conquer the trail with your North Face backpack as your trusty companion.

Optimize Your Carry: Smart Packing Techniques for Your North Face Backpack

Heading out on an adventure and need to stuff everything into your trusty North Face backpack? It's a common challenge, but with some savvy packing techniques, you can maximize your carry and ensure you have room for all your essential gear. First, roll your clothes neatly to save space and prevent wrinkles. Utilize packing cubes to organize items and keep things tidy. Don't forget to spread the weight of your backpack by placing heavier items closer to your back and lighter items towards the top. For quick-access items, like snacks or a water bottle, consider using a hanging organizer. By following these simple tips, you can get the best out of your North Face backpack and be ready for anything.
